An Azul Linhas Aereas Embraer ERJ-190, registration PR-AZA performing flight AD-9063 from Florianopolis,SC to Rio de Janeiro Santos Dumont,RJ (Brazil), was descending towards Rio de Janeiro, when the crew decided to divert to Rio de Janeiro's Galeao Airport due to longer runways available reporting a brakes problem. The airecraft landed safely at Galeao Airport.

A passenger reported the captain announced during the descent they had a brakes problem and would divert to Galeao Airport because of the longer runways available. The landing roll was long, the reversers were used for a longer than usual time, however nothing dramatic.

The occurrence aircraft remained on the ground for about 12.5 hours, then departed for flight AD-9642 from Galeao Airport to Sao Paulo Viracopos.
